More information
Pvt Edgar R. Brant enlisted on 4 November 1943 and was stationed at Camp Wolters, Texas and Fort Bragg, North Carolina. He was sent overseas in August 1944.He was first buried at Temporary American Military Cemetery of Limey, France.
